I actually got my first taste of Trapanese pizza. Calvino’s is a place that started in 1946…so it’s older than me! You get a room to eat your pizza and you have a time slot in which to consume it. The round pizza is cut into tiny one inch squares…only in Trapani. I could only eat half. The boys told me that the building used to be a house of ill repute!

My young friends explained to me that you need to go out late in order to enjoy the atmosphere of this town. People don’t start going out until at least eight or 9 o’clock at night and stay out till two in the morning. I am approaching one month here, alone in Sicily. I’m conflicted as I am having a hard time making a move to leave. I become very comfortable in my little apartment and my surroundings but I certainly miss my family. I had a group call with them on Sunday and after I got off the phone I started to tear up quite a bit. I just have not taken the time to find a flight back to America…. maybe there is something to be said about that. So I try to keep busy to fight off the malaise…and busy I have certainly been. This past week I had three great interactions with local people who have become my friends. I had a cooking class with Cristina here in my apartment. She taught me her version of Sicilian Trapanese style caponata. On Thursday I went to Marsala a city south of here, famous for wine, with master teacher and guide Gianni Grillo and I finished off the week with a birthday party with my new friends.
I am working hard at getting my mind formed to go back to America. I miss my family and friends and the business that I’ve been involved with for 50 years but there’s something magical in this place…something musical in the conversations that I hear and the sounds of the language and the ringing of the bells and the wind and the sun and the aged crumbling buildings…it is the land where I came from, and I can feel the ancient ties to the land and the people and the soil, and the angst and joy of all those who have lived before me.
